How to Install and Uninstall libreofficekit.i686 Package on Fedora 34
Last updated: October 05,2024
1. Install "libreofficekit.i686" package
This is a short guide on how to install libreofficekit.i686 on Fedora 34
$
sudo dnf update
Copied
$
sudo dnf install
libreofficekit.i686
Copied
2. Uninstall "libreofficekit.i686" package
Please follow the step by step instructions below to uninstall libreofficekit.i686 on Fedora 34:
$
sudo dnf remove
libreofficekit.i686
Copied
$
sudo dnf autoremove
Copied
3. Information about the libreofficekit.i686 package on Fedora 34
Last metadata expiration check: 2:04:33 ago on Tue Sep 6 14:10:38 2022.
Available Packages
Name : libreofficekit
Epoch : 1
Version : 7.1.8.1
Release : 4.fc34
Architecture : i686
Size : 109 k
Source : libreoffice-7.1.8.1-4.fc34.src.rpm
Repository : updates
Summary : A library providing access to LibreOffice functionality
URL : http://www.libreoffice.org/
License : MPLv2.0
Description : LibreOfficeKit can be used to access LibreOffice functionality
: through C/C++, without any need to use UNO.
:
: For now it only offers document conversion (in addition to an
: experimental tiled rendering API).
